Output 57ac758403005fcea8de676f52916747a853662f415ebbfafdd115dbff1fbb30:0

value
2447697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 983affc7448cb28b07b0c06773e74855e1c9d25f OP_EQUALVERIFY OP_CHECKSIG
address
1EsvPVRArVv1JijoiMyZffwEKRbUXiXczw
transaction
57ac758403005fcea8de676f52916747a853662f415ebbfafdd115dbff1fbb30
spent
true